Output 5948ee856f7d84a2cbb9b09b60fc3d78e37a8336c5c2ba55dc272d486db3f60e:48

value
5238504
script pubkey
OP_HASH160 OP_PUSHBYTES_20 dec70d65e1916bcc81dc1aa9f2ba30f1beb1e040 OP_EQUAL
address
3MzxPXdML7X48VorUttawSbM5WtthCVrMJ
transaction
5948ee856f7d84a2cbb9b09b60fc3d78e37a8336c5c2ba55dc272d486db3f60e
confirmations
359875
spent
true